In spite of the ecumenical movement, Catholics and Protestants who marry face areas of potential conflict. Where will they worship? How do they approach the differences in their beliefs? What about their children's religions instruction? Whether you are already part of a "mixed marriage" or thinking about it, you will find this book a helpful guide. through interviews with couples involved in Catholic-Protestant marriages, and speaking from her own experience as a partner in a "mixed marriage," Barbara Schlappa offers practical steps for working through your differences. As in any good marriage, some effort is involved. But if you are willing to work at understanding each other's faith, you can resolve the dilemmas facing you and may find your marriage to be a source of Christian growth and unity. Parents of Catholic-Protestant couples, clergy and marriage counselors will also benefit from the helpful and hopeful book.
